But back on topic: I consider the Swiss to have the gold standard in passenger rail transport, just as the US has the gold standard in freight rail.
Having said that, the Swiss are not afraid to close down marginal rail lines. Examples are the RhB line from Belinzona to Mesocco and the Biasca to Aquarossa operation. They certainly do not operate passenger rail willy-nilly whithout regards to costs. They simply are focused on providing a quality product which operates on time. You can set your watch to it.
